Quote from: ADC on Aug 17, 2013, 03:51:41 PM
Nice chat fellas. Taking up Aaron's question, does anyone know the origin of the 'unravelling box-Alien'? I'm pretty sure I heard or read something about this years ago but can't recall the story.

The writer and/or artist were apparently asked about this, many years ago and they swore blind that it was in the cut which was screened to them. They have no idea what happened to it, but said it was definitely in there. The trouble with verifying it is that none of the production crew ever seems to get asked about it, which has made it a kind of anomaly. Giger's never mentioned it, but many of his designs were passed onto others to construct and they could always have made it out of left-overs from stuff made earlier. His new book might have something about it.

Wouldn't surprise me, because from what I can remember, there was meant to have been a lot of footage which had been removed for various reasons, well over the amount we've all seen. I've never even seen pictures of the famous translucent creature costume until very recently.

Wrrvrvrvrvrm (forget how you spell their name) might've been the one to have brought this to light, but I can't say for sure. Was on the News Group and I haven't been there in a very long time.

Either way, it should be kept in mind that Fox would have had to approve it before publishing.

There is an interview with Ridley Scott that mentions about the alien in 'box-like' shape but was never filmed.  He wanted to have the alien seen on monitors on the bridge in which the alien is in a strange shape.  I'm sure one member said the 'box' scene was 'blocked' or something.  This is going back a while.  But for the life in me I can't find the interview.  I'll have to go through all my material.  There's also a a scene in the Illustrated story that come to my attention such as the scene in which Dallas confronts Ash. 

(https://www.avpgalaxy.net/forum/proxy.php?request=http%3A%2F%2F3.bp.blogspot.com%2F-XzFyhsRGFcE%2FUaUhiBZoZgI%2FAAAAAAAAFVI%2FVobsGeWWByA%2Fs640%2FDalls%2B%26amp%3B%2BAsh.jpg&hash=ef36fab9db32be362b5bd285dd309aa5fed47bd5)

There's no mention of it anywhere and in the Terry Rawlings editing script he writes:

(https://www.avpgalaxy.net/forum/proxy.php?request=http%3A%2F%2F4.bp.blogspot.com%2F-QgdzdNw3Qto%2FUaUivlgySsI%2FAAAAAAAAFVU%2F-dCzRkHdNMo%2Fs400%2FDeleted.jpg&hash=9b51cd91ef8dd41e804fe6757d3b03d87c12e8f0)

I've been trying to find out if this scene was filmed or not or just added because it was in the script.
